Part 1: Understanding Wellness Coaching Certification
Wellness Coaching certification is formal recognition of your expertise in helping individuals achieve and maintain a state of well-being in various aspects of their lives, including physical, mental, emotional, and social wellness. It signifies your ability to provide guidance, support, and motivation to empower clients to make positive lifestyle changes.
Part 2: Steps to Wellness Coaching Certification
- Research Certification Organizations: Begin by researching reputable certification organizations recognized in the health and wellness industry for offering Wellness Coaching certification exams. Look for organizations that align with your career goals and values.
- Choose a Certification Program: Select a Wellness Coaching certification program that suits your career aspirations. Certifications can vary in focus, including general wellness coaching or specialized areas like stress management, nutrition, or holistic wellness.
- Enroll in the Certification Exam: Register for the Wellness Coaching certification exam offered by your chosen organization. Dedicate time to learn and understand the exam materials specific to wellness principles, coaching techniques, and ethical guidelines.
- Study and Prepare: Thoroughly study the exam materials, covering topics such as wellness fundamentals, behavior change theories, communication skills, and goal-setting techniques.
- Gain Practical Experience: Acquire practical experience by working with clients or individuals who seek guidance in improving their overall wellness. Practical experience is essential for mastering coaching techniques and understanding the unique needs of clients.
- Take the Certification Exam: Successfully complete the Wellness Coaching certification exam. The exam will assess your knowledge of wellness principles, effective coaching strategies, communication skills, and ethical considerations.
- Maintain Certification: After achieving Wellness Coaching certification, maintain it by fulfilling continuing education requirements. This may involve taking advanced wellness coaching exams, attending workshops, or earning credits to stay updated with industry trends and guidelines.
Part 3: Specializations and Advanced Certifications
Consider pursuing specializations or advanced certifications within Wellness Coaching to expand your expertise and offer specialized guidance, such as:
- Nutrition Coaching: Focus on helping clients make healthier food choices and develop sustainable dietary habits.
- Stress Management Coaching: Specialize in assisting clients in managing stress and building resilience.
- Holistic Wellness Coaching: Address wellness from a holistic perspective, considering physical, emotional, and spiritual aspects of well-being.
